SUDDEN DEATH


Unpure Burial
10 tracks - playing time: 42:00 min.
Locomotive Records
Rating: 7/10
 
Sometimes I listen to a cd which I like very much but still nothing sticks. Unpure Burial from Sudden Death is a cd just like that. Sudden Death also reminds me of another band I have the same experience with, called Pissing Razors. Musically and vocally they have some in common. Unpure Burial is Sudden Death`s first album and was already released in the USA a half a year ago. Now, the album will be released in Europe. This is an album which will not upset you; a perfect festival background cd. Pure (thrash) metal, but also some influences from Pantera and heavy nu-metal.

These ten songs are mean and the band really showcases their passion for metal. However, I wonder if people will decide to buy this cd, because generally, it is a little bit too mediocre. As a whole, it listens pretty well, but it sounds just like a 42-minute metal grenade with nothing really memorable. This cd mostly reminds me of the `94-`98 era in which a lot of bands like Frozen Sun (Danish), Pissing Razors, Frastuono and Headshot - to name but a few - were making this kind of music. Brutal and heavy, yet no classic.
